Craves colour and business

I wasn't particularly enthused when my scans first came back, but with a little reflection I've decided I like Lomo 100 and would repurchase. I was also surprised slightly (and happily) by how sharp it can be.

It thrives in busy and very colourful scenes, which isn't really what I used it for and that's where I went wrong. I'd repurchase and reuse for events - definitely for my road's next street party!

Fun in the Sun

Quite impressed with this film. I expected high contrast & saturated colours and it delivers these for sure but pleasantly surprised with the skin tone rendition too. Obviously this is not Portra but if you're taking it somewhere bright, sunny and colourful it'll give you vibrant images and if there are people in them they won't end up like Umpa Lumpas. Take it on a summer holiday!
